Fire shutters are typically installed in buildings to create compartmentalization, preventing the spread of fire from one area to another. They are commonly used in industrial and commercial buildings, as well as in residential structures where fire safety is a top priority. Fire shutters are designed to automatically close in the event of a fire, effectively sealing off the affected area and containing the fire to prevent further damage.

One crucial aspect of fire shutter detail is the material used in their construction. Fire shutters are typically made of fire-resistant materials such as steel or aluminum, which have the ability to withstand high temperatures for extended periods of time. These materials are also durable and long-lasting, ensuring that the fire shutters will effectively perform their function when needed.

Another important detail in fire shutter design is the mechanism used to operate them. Fire shutters are equipped with either manual or automatic mechanisms that allow them to be deployed quickly in the event of a fire. Automatic fire shutters are triggered by fire detection systems, closing automatically to contain the fire and prevent its spread. Manual fire shutters, on the other hand, are operated by building occupants or emergency personnel to seal off areas as needed.

In addition to material and operation mechanisms, the design of fire shutters also includes various features that enhance their effectiveness. For example, some fire shutters are equipped with smoke seals that prevent the passage of smoke between compartments, further containing the fire and reducing the risk of smoke inhalation. Other fire shutters may have insulated slats that provide additional protection against heat transfer, maintaining the integrity of the shutter even in high-temperature environments.

Proper installation of fire shutters is also a critical detail that should not be overlooked. Fire shutters should be installed by qualified professionals in accordance with building codes and regulations to ensure their effectiveness in a fire emergency. Improper installation can compromise the functionality of fire shutters, rendering them ineffective in containing and preventing the spread of fire.

Regular maintenance and inspection of fire shutters are essential to ensure that they are in good working condition at all times. Routine inspections can identify any issues or damage that may affect the performance of fire shutters, allowing for prompt repairs or replacements as needed. It is recommended that fire shutters be inspected annually by qualified professionals to ensure their reliability and functionality in the event of a fire.
